She can refuse, which means that she has lost confidence in her government.

The last monarch to refuse assent to an act of parliament was Queen Anne in 1707.

She would rather be Queen than be right.

Well, that is what modern constitutional monarchy is about -- staying around by not exercising direct power.

A monarch who habitually refused assent to legislative acts would quickly become an ex-monarch.

Look at what happened to Queen Anne's father, uncle, and grandfather.
